S.Res. 180 (101st)

A resolution to encourage schools and civic enterprises to observe the 200th anniversary of the Bill of Rights on September 25, 1989.

Summary

Recognizes September 25, 1989, as the 200th anniversary of the Bill of Rights. Encourages schools and civic enterprises to observe such anniversary by reading and discussing the meaning of the Bill of Rights.
